Highly popular in Asia, laser toning employs thousands of pulses of Nd:YAG laser light energy of the Clarity II™ to  improve the appearance of the skin in both the short run and the long term. The procedure results in instant rejuvenation of the face, neck, hands and décolleté because it plumps, smooths and clarifies.  Laser Toning also promotes sub-dermal collagen production so that skin texture, color and tone continue to improve long after your appointment. Regular laser toning can diminish surface flaws like wrinkles, brown spots, freckles, or imperfections caused by conditions like acne and rosacea.  Laser toning is painless, though patients may experience a sensation of heat as the laser wand passes over the skin.  Laser Toning, known by us as ‘The Gym for the Skin,’ is an essential element of the CLarity II™ Alex Toning Facial and CLarity II™ Collagen Toning Facial, two of our signature treatments designed for superior maintenance of skin health and beauty.

As with any laser procedure, be sure to follow treatment with adequate sun protection.

Laser Toning is often combined with other procedures, for optimal results. It complements a wide variety of other aesthetic treatments and can be performed on the same day as facials, chemical peels, more aggressive lasers, and RF microneedling, and dermal fillers. The use of a medical grade skincare regime is recommended and can profoundly improve the final outcome.

A major advantage of Clarity II™ Laser Toning is that there is no downtime, and minimal risk of side effects. You can achieve a smoother, more youthful skin with minimal interruption to your normal routine. Typically 3-8 sessions are required depending on the severity of the skin concern.

Contraindications include but are not limited to the following:

          • Pregnancy or breastfeeding
          • Accutane (isotretinoin) in the last 6 months
          • Retin A topical or other skin-irritating products
          • Aesthetic procedures / injections in the last 2 weeks
          • Blood-thinning medications within the last week
            (  Aspirin, iron supplements, herbal supplements such as ginkgo, ginseng, garlic, or St. John’s Wort )
          • History of keloid scarring or abnormal wound healing
          • Skin cancer or suspicious lesions
          • Sunburn (natural sunlight, tanning), extreme sensitivity, rosacea
          • Poorly controlled medical conditions (i.e. diabetes, vascular)
          • Impaired immune system and/or use of immunosuppressive medications
          • Tattoos and/or permanent makeup
          • Implanted medical devices in the treatment area
          • Impaired judgment, psychological conditions, and substance or alcohol abuse.
          • Patients with unrealistic expectations

Before Your Treatment

          • You may not be pregnant or lactating.
          • Patients who have used Accutane or similar products within the last 6 months CANNOT be treated.
          • Discontinue the use of any topical products that may be drying or irritating (e.g. AHAs, BHAs, retinoids) 3-7 days prior.
          • Avoid anti-inflammatory drugs (NSAIDs) for at least 3 days prior. These actions may interfere with the natural inflammatory process critical to proper healing and skin rejuvenation.
          • Avoid taking any blood-thinning agents for 3 – 7 days prior unless otherwise prescribed by your physician.
          • Avoid unprotected sun exposure, or tanning for at least 2 weeks prior to your procedure. Always use an SPF 30 or higher containing zinc oxide and/or titanium dioxide for proper sun protection.
          • Avoid other aesthetic procedures and cosmetic injections in the area(s) to be treated for 2 weeks before and after.
          • If you are prone to cold sores, it is recommended to take antiviral medication for 7 days before and after.
          • Stay hydrated by drinking 8+ glasses of water daily to improve results & healing time.


Day of Treatment

          • Arrive with clean skin free of any lotion, oil, makeup, powder, or sunscreen.
          • Notify your practitioner of any changes in your medication, or health status, or personal activities that may be relevant to your treatment.
          • Topical numbing using ice packs may be used to maximize your comfort during the treatment.


After Your Treatment


What to Expect:

          • Patients will experience mild to moderate erythema (redness), edema (swelling), or a warm stinging / sunburn-like sensation for several days post-treatment, however for more aggressive treatments, these symptoms may last longer than 3 days.
          • Other possible skin reactions include irritation, itching, and general sensitivity, which may last for 3 or more days.
          • Results are both immediate and progressive. Multiple treatments may be required to achieve individually desired results.
          • Commonly patients experience purging of water retention caused by swelling and impurities in the form of water blisters or acne breakouts. This is normal and should resolve within a few days.


48 Hour Care:

          • DO NOT wear Makeup for at least 48 hours.
          • Avoid all strenuous activity for a minimum of 48 hours as sweating increases infection risk.
          • DO NOT USE ICE on the treatment area. DO NOT use any anti-inflammatory drugs (NSAIDs). These actions may interfere with the natural inflammatory process critical to proper healing and skin rejuvenation.
          • DO NOT pick, scratch, excessively rub or scrub the treatment area. It is imperative to allow natural healing to minimize post-treatment complications. Treat the skin gently as if you have a sunburn.


General Care: 

          • Care should be taken to prevent trauma to the treated area especially for the first few days after your procedure.
          • You may take Tylenol for post-treatment discomfort or Benadryl / Zyrtec if you experience excessive itching (histamine reaction).
          • Avoid All Direct & Indirect Sun Exposure.
          • Always use an SPF 30 or higher containing zinc oxide and/or titanium dioxide for proper sun protection. It is safe to begin the use of SPF starting 24-48 hours after your treatment.
          • Do not have any other treatments for at least 1 – 2 weeks following treatment or until the skin has completely healed.
          • Your practitioner will make individual recommendations on when to resume normal skincare (typically after 2 days).
          • Keep the treated area well hydrated (specifically for the first 2 days).


If you experience any side effects, such as prolonged redness or swelling, histamine reaction, blisters, burns, or signs of infection please contact your practitioner immediately for proper assessment and further care instructions.
